Most of us use, or have used, smoke detectors in our homes that come from a hardware store and use a simple battery. This type of detector will definitely wake you in the night when smoke reaches it, or let you know there’s a situation while you’re home at dinner. But what happens when you leave for work, or for extended vacation?
Protect your home and belongings by adding fire protection to your current security system. When the system is monitored, you can be notified no matter where you are, and an event can be promptly reported to the Fire Department. Most insurance companies will give discounts for having a monitored fire system in your home.

Security Systems
There are ways to go about finding the best security contractor for you. Ask your friends, family, neighbors or insurance agent for referrals. Don’t forget to ask about an insurance discount for having a monitored security system in your home or business. Call several companies and ask if their employees are trained and/or certified by a nationally recognized entity like ESA (Electronic Security Association) or the system’s manufacturer. Check how often drug tests and background checks are performed. Ask the company for proof of applicable state and/or local licenses. When a representative is at your door, ask for company identification.
Avoiding the wrong security company is equally important. Some alarm companies may not sufficiently certify their technicians or have the correct state licenses so make sure to check before signing any contract.
Beware of high pressure door-to-door salespeople, for two main reasons: one, some are not salespeople at all. They’re just impersonators trying to find out about any existing alarm system you have, possibly casing your home for a burglary. Two, some use a tactic called “slamming”: the salesperson falsely tells you that your current alarm company has gone out of business and has passed your account on to another firm. (Guess whose?) Fall for this one and you can be saddled with double billing, higher service fees and hassles when you wise up and try to cancel the new provider. Agents may offer “free” equipment, in exchange for allowing their company sign on your front lawn. Typically this involves signing a long-term contract that involves highly inflated monthly charges.
